Difference between IOS versions
Hi. What is the difference between these 2 versions of Cisco IOS?
c870-advipservicesk9-mz.124-24.T1.bin
c870-advsecurityk9-mz.124-24.T1.bin
I know the advanced security IOS supports VPNs. Does this mean the Advanced IP Services IOS does not support VPNs?

The advanced IP services will contain all the features of the advanced security feature set.
When in doubt always consult the Cisco Feature Navigator.An expert is a man who has made all the mistakes which can be made. -
